37mm 500 Rpm 12V DC motor With Gearbox Parameter List
Ratio | Gearbox | No Load | Rated Load | Stall | ||||
i : 1 | Length | Current | Speed | Current | Speed | Torque | Current | Torque |
6.3:1 | 19.0mm | ≤0.2A | 1,530rpm | ≤2.0A | 1,030rpm | 0.6kg.cm | ≤6.0A | 1.6kg.cm |
10:1 | 19.0mm | ≤0.2A | 960rpm | ≤2.0A | 650rpm | 1.0kg.cm | ≤6.0A | 2.7kg.cm |
18.8:1 | 21.5mm | ≤0.2A | 510rpm | ≤2.0A | 346rpm | 1.8kg.cm | ≤6.0A | 4.8kg.cm |
30:1 | 22.0mm | ≤0.2A | 320rpm | ≤2.0A | 215rpm | 3.0kg.cm | ≤6.0A | 7.5kg.cm |
50:1 | 24.0mm | ≤0.2A | 192rpm | ≤2.0A | 130rpm | 4.8kg.cm | ≤6.0A | 13.0kg.cm |
90:1 | 24.0mm | ≤0.2A | 107rpm | ≤2.0A | 72rpm | 8.5kg.cm | ≤6.0A | 21.0kg.cm |
150:1 | 26.5mm | ≤0.2A | 64rpm | ≤2.0A | 43rpm | 14.5kg.cm | ≤6.0A | 33.0kg.cm |
260:1 | 26.5mm | ≤0.2A | 35rpm | ≤2.0A | 25rpm | 20.0kg.cm | ≤6.0A | ≥35.0kg.cm; not allowed stalling |
450:1 | 29.0mm | ≤0.2A | 21rpm | ≤2.0A | 14rpm | 25.0kg.cm | ≤6.0A | ≥35.0kg.cm; not allowed stalling |
630:1 | 29.0mm | ≤0.2A | 15.5rpm | ≤2.0A | 10rpm | 30.0kg.cm | ≤6.0A | ≥35.0kg.cm; not allowed stalling |

Key Components Of GB37-528 Mini Gear Motor Dirver
Gearbox Structure & FunctionalityA gear reduction motor integrates a high torque gearbox composed of multiple gears. Its primary role is to reduce the input speed of the drive motor while amplifying the output torque, enabling efficient power transfer for demanding applications. | ![]() | The stator forms the stationary foundation of a DC gear motor, housing essential parts such as main magnetic poles, commutation poles, a durable frame, and brush assemblies. These elements work together to generate the magnetic field required for rotor movement. |
Rotor AssemblyIn micro gear motors, the rotor acts as the rotating core. It includes the armature core, armature windings, commutator, and a precision-engineered rotating shaft. This assembly converts electrical energy into mechanical motion, driving the motor’s operation. | Bearings & Worm GearsBearings and worm gears are critical in gear reduction motors for supporting rotational motion and power transmission. Bearings ensure smooth, low-friction operation, while worm gears efficiently transfer torque between perpendicular axes, enhancing the high torque gearbox’s reliability and performance. |
